Investing in HIV/AIDS prevention programs not only saves lives but also yields significant economic returns by reducing healthcare costs, increasing productivity, and averting the social and economic impacts of the epidemic. From condom distribution and needle exchange programs to comprehensive sex education and PrEP, prevention interventions are cost-effective strategies for reducing HIV transmission and improving public health outcomes. By prioritizing prevention, we can not only save money but also save lives and build healthier, more prosperous communities for future generations.
